The concept of Zero Gravity applies to mental health in several ways

Our vision at Zero Gravity Counseling was shaped by the journey of the astronaut. Astronauts do not begin their work in space; they prepare carefully, train with support, and move through challenge, uncertainty, and adjustment before ever experiencing weightlessness. The shift into zero gravity does not erase difficulty, but it changes how the weight is carried and what becomes possible.

In much the same way, we view healing as a process rather than a destination. Life experiences, stress, and past challenges can create a sense of heaviness that limits movement, perspective, and possibility. Our vision is to offer a therapeutic space where individuals can begin to set some of that weight down, explore their experiences with support, and discover new ways of relating to themselves and their lives.

The astronaut for us, symbolizes curiosity, resilience, and adaptation. In zero gravity, perspectives shift and movement looks different. At Zero Gravity Counseling, we aim to support individuals in gently examining long-held patterns, expanding perspective, and building skills that allow for growth and steadiness over time. This process honors that each person’s journey is unique and unfolds at its own rhythm.

We envision therapy as a place where people are supported, challenged thoughtfully, and met with respect. Through collaboration, evidence-based care, and meaningful human connection, we strive to help individuals navigate their experiences with greater understanding, balance, and possibility.
